Job description

Overview

Dubai, United Arab Emirates — Assistant Manager – Reporting role based in Dubai, UAE, supporting the financial reporting and accounting function within a well-established organisation. This role plays a key part in ensuring accurate financial reporting, regulatory compliance, and the effective management of accounting processes.

Responsibilities
  • Conduct detailed reviews and reconciliations of accounting processes prior to final approval by senior management
  • Support the preparation and finalisation of quarterly and annual financial statements
  • Supervise day-to-day accounting operations in line with established guidelines and best practices
  • Review journal entries, transaction postings, and financial data for accuracy and completeness
  • Perform preliminary reviews of Accounts Receivable (AR), Accounts Payable (AP), and General Ledger accounts, resolving discrepancies in coordination with relevant stakeholders
  • Oversee reconciliation processes, including cash, bank, and trial balance reviews
  • Monitor and supervise reinsurance and third-party insurer accounts
  • Support and guide accounting team members, including training on systems and procedures
  • Coordinate with internal and external auditors, including managing audit fieldwork requirements
  • Ensure accurate financial data entry and system usage within the ERP environment
  • Support compliance with financial policies, procedures, and regulatory requirements
  • Assist in implementing finance-related initiatives and process improvements
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in accounting, Finance, or a related field
  • Professional certifications such as ACCA, CA, or CPA are preferred
  • 3–5 years of accounting experience within the insurance sector, with supervisory exposure
  • Strong knowledge of IFRS 17 and IFRS 9 (mandatory)
  • Experience managing accounting processes, reporting, and reconciliations
  • Strong analytical, organizational, and problem-solving skills
  • High attention to detail and accuracy
  • Good communication and stakeholder management skills
  • Experience working with financial ERP systems
